Among the most fun you can have at Toy Fair is checking out the Royal Bobbles booth, and this year they had several neat new licenses and characters on display for upcoming products. They're working on a lineup of presidential busts, represented in their booth by early prototypes of Abraham Lincoln and George Washington in both painted and bronze finish versions. These were digitally sculpted and will be further refined before release, and show off just a couple of the different paint possibilities. The big news from Royal was a quartet of new items that should see release soon. Pope Francis and Bigfoot (based on the classic pose from the grainy video) are nearly ready, while Mr. Bean and Pee-wee Herman are awaiting final licensor approval and any last revisions. The Pee-wee is interesting because it's the first Paul Reubens product based on his actual face. He's been working very closely with Royal on the bobblehead and is very excited about the project! In addition, facing the challenge of representing Herman's plaid suit the artists came up with a very interesting solution; Pee-wee's suit is actually sculpted with square sections in different elevations which when painted give the illusion of plaid. Pee-wee should go into production in early summer.
